When I was playing Xenoblade my CCP disconnected and then reconnected to my remote. Later it did it again, but then stayed disconnected. I took the chord connecting my CCP to the Wiimote out, blew in the socket,and plugged it back in. It is still having problems. This happened to me once with a crappy 3rd Party version, but this is an official new Nintendo CCP. I want to know how to fix this, if it has happened to anyone else, and what might be wrong. Please, Help. Thank you.

Sounds like it could be a lose wire in the CCP. Does the same thing happen if you plug the Nunchuck into the Wiimote? If it does that with the Nunchuck plugged in as well than it could be the Wiimote itself.

actually, i remember having a lot of problems keeping my Nunchuk attached properly to my wiimote during the beginning of Xenoblade (i'd say at least the first ten hours or so in-game). it seemed like it'd disconnect at the drop of a hat, i had to be very careful how i held the nunchuk and all or else it'd disconnect on me. throughout the rest of the game it was absolutely fine, though. i wonder if it's just a peculiarity of the game itself that it doesn't like things connected to the wiimote in the early portion of the game... did anyone else have this sort of problem?
